This is a two-year scheme with placements across the business, providing hands-on experience across the pathway you choose, whether it’s Engineering, Science, Safety, Health, Environment & Quality (SHEQ), Human Resources (HR), Project Management or Corporate and Operations.
We keep things flexible so that you can tailor your journey within a particular area. But we don’t mess about with career development; you’ll get leadership, business and ‘soft skills’ training like communication or presenting. We will also support you towards professional registration like Chartership.

What are the benefits?
– £31,000 salary
– A welcome payment
– Access to discounts and a pension scheme
– Mentorship from world-class professionals
– 270 hours of annual leave plus a nine-day fortnight
– Leadership and business training

Continual support
You will be supported by a dedicated line manager and Evolve pathway lead who will help your transition into the business, provide pastoral support and work with you on your development journey.
You will also be assigned a buddy, usually a fellow graduate from an earlier year, to show you the ropes.
